How do I give a partial refund to a buyer?

I have a buyer who had to cover extra at the post office because of a problem on my end and I need to refund some money. How do I do this?

How do I give a partial refund to a buyer?

If the buyer is returning the item you'll have to refund excess postage outside of eBay (PayPal, Venmo, Zelle, mail a check, etc).

 

If the buyer is happy with the item and plans to keep it, you can send a partial refund through the transaction. Instructions here: https://www.ebay.com/help/selling/managing-returns-refunds/refunding-buyers?id=5182

 

 

Edit to add: the reason for the different process is because sending a partial refund when the buyer plans to return means you're affecting the amount they'll be refunded upon return. To avoid hat you have to refund the postage issue outside the transaction.
